A guide to the transformational alchemy of the five elements: spirit, fire, water, earth and air. Glennie describes the qualities of each element and offers rituals and ceremonies to help us work with these energies. There is also a section about how to make a 10 stone system for asking inner questions and developing intution, based on the five elements and the Celtic festivals

Glennie Kindred is known for her collection of books about Celtic festivals, native British trees, healing the Earth, and hedgerow medicine. My favourite are her illustrated hand-sewn books that she produces herself. This book is the latest in that collection and is described as a guide to the transformational alchemy of the five elements: spirit, fire, water, earth and air. It explores the idea that by positively changing ourselves using techniques such as non-violent communication and inner reflection, our ripple effect will spread to our friends, families, communities and bring change into the wiser world.Review
Glennie is very careful to write inclusively and this book wears no ‘badge’ of belief, but rather encourages our own right-relations between ourselves and the earth. Elements of Change is bound to be appreciated.
